Morocco Plans Phased Reopening of International Flights Starting June 15

International flights to and from Morocco should resume as of June 15, according to sources close to the Moroccan authorities.
The resumption of international flights would be gradual, informs the site goud.ma which specifies that Moroccans living abroad would be the only ones concerned by this first wave.
A total reopening of the borders would be expected on July 07 next, adds the same source which indicates that the authorities should make an official announcement on this subject by June 10.
